About H S Thompson Learning Center

H S Thompson Learning Center is a public elementary school in Dallas, TX, part of DALLAS ISD. H S Thompson Learning Center serves approximately 483 students, and covers grades Kindergarten-5th, and has a 13.1:1 student-teacher ratio. H S Thompson Learning Center has a current MySchoolScout rating of 7.0 out of 10 and ranks #3,223 of 8,552 schools in TX.

Structured state assessment records for H S Thompson Learning Center show 12%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2022-2024) and 20%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2022-2024).

What Parents Should Know

Test scores at H S Thompson Learning Center sit below average, but its growth scores are strong: students here make above-average progress year over year. The raw numbers haven't caught up, but a school that keeps moving kids forward is doing the harder, more important work.

36% of students at H S Thompson Learning Center were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
